DeviceTemperatureConfiguration¶
- class st.zigbee.zcl.clusters.DeviceTemperatureConfiguration¶
- ID: number¶
0x0002 the ID of this cluster
- NAME: str¶
“DeviceTemperatureConfiguration” the name of this cluster
- attributes: st.zigbee.zcl.clusters.DeviceTemperatureConfigurationServerAttributes or st.zigbee.zcl.clusters.DeviceTemperatureConfigurationClientAttributes¶
- commands: st.zigbee.zcl.clusters.DeviceTemperatureConfigurationServerCommands or st.zigbee.zcl.clusters.DeviceTemperatureConfigurationClientCommands¶
- types: st.zigbee.zcl.clusters.DeviceTemperatureConfigurationTypes¶

- class st.zigbee.zcl.clusters.DeviceTemperatureConfiguration.DeviceTempAlarmMask¶
- ID: number¶
0x0010 the ID of this attribute
- NAME: str¶
“DeviceTempAlarmMask” the name of this attribute
- data_type: st.zigbee.data_types.Bitmap8¶
the data type of this attribute
- DEVICE_TEMPERATURE_TOO_LOW: number¶
1
- DEVICE_TEMPERATURE_TOO_HIGH: number¶
2
- is_device_temperature_too_low_set()¶
- Returns:
True if the value of DEVICE_TEMPERATURE_TOO_LOW is non-zero
- Return type:
boolean
- set_device_temperature_too_low()¶
Set the value of the bit in the DEVICE_TEMPERATURE_TOO_LOW field to 1
- unset_device_temperature_too_low()¶
Set the value of the bits in the DEVICE_TEMPERATURE_TOO_LOW field to 0
- is_device_temperature_too_high_set()¶
- Returns:
True if the value of DEVICE_TEMPERATURE_TOO_HIGH is non-zero
- Return type:
boolean
- set_device_temperature_too_high()¶
Set the value of the bit in the DEVICE_TEMPERATURE_TOO_HIGH field to 1
- unset_device_temperature_too_high()¶
Set the value of the bits in the DEVICE_TEMPERATURE_TOO_HIGH field to 0
